Additionally, mineral wool boards offer exceptional fire resistance. They can withstand high temperatures without melting or releasing toxic fumes, making them an ideal choice for insulation in fire-prone areas. This fire-resistant property enhances building safety and meets stringent building regulations, giving homeowners and builders peace of mind.


Gyproc is a brand renowned for its high-quality plasterboard products, while PVC, or polyvinyl chloride, is a synthetic plastic polymer widely used in construction. A Gyproc PVC false ceiling combines these materials, resulting in a lightweight, durable, and cost-effective ceiling solution. It offers the sleek appearance of a traditional ceiling while providing additional benefits that cater to modern design needs.

2. Ease of Installation and Maintenance One of the key benefits of T-bar ceilings is their straightforward installation process. Contractors can quickly install the grid system with minimal disruption. In case of damage or for routine maintenance, individual ceiling tiles can be easily removed and replaced without affecting the entire ceiling.

Fibre ceiling sheets are also low-maintenance materials. They are easy to clean and can often be wiped down or vacuumed to remove dust and dirt, which is essential for maintaining a healthy indoor air quality. Their resistance to stains and scratches further enhances their longevity, making them an economically viable choice over time.

    On the other hand, PVC ceiling tiles are considerably easier and quicker to install. They can be directly glued to the existing ceiling or fitted into a grid system, making them a great DIY option for homeowners. Their lightweight nature allows for hassle-free handling, reducing the overall time and labor costs associated with installation.

    Installation of a suspended ceiling tile grid is relatively straightforward, making it a cost-effective alternative to traditional ceilings. The installation process involves measuring the space, cutting the grid to size, and securing it to the upper framework of the room. DIY enthusiasts can often tackle this project themselves, while professionals can ensure an efficient and precise installation.
